Ertz doesn't want a torn ACL to write the last line

There is a version of how this ends that Zach Ertz has already decided to refuse.

Ertz has spent years as one of the more reliable tight ends in the league โ€” the kind of player whose name got called in moments that mattered. Then last season a torn ACL took the choice out of his hands, and now he is a free agent with something to prove before anyone will give him a roster spot.

In April, he said it plainly: he does not want this injury to be the last thing he did in the NFL. To get back on a field in 2026, he knows he has to show up healthy first. No team will take the leap on faith alone.

That is the work right now. Not games, not targets โ€” just the long, unglamorous process of convincing his body, and then convincing a front office, that there is still something left.

The ACL gets to decide a lot of things. Whether it writes the ending is still an open question.
